Skip to main content

How to get from Barberà Del Vallès to Bellpuig by train?

From Barberà Del Vallès to Bellpuig by train

Take one direct train from Barberà Del Vallès to Bellpuig in Barcelona: take the R12 train from Barberà Del Vallès station to Bellpuig station. The total trip duration for this route is approximately 2 hr 31 min. The ride fare is €5.90.

151min€5.90
Walk to train stationTrain - R12
Train - R12
Walk to Bellpuig
Leaves from Barberà Del Vallès

Step by Step

  • 1
    Walk to train station
    Walk to train station
    Barberà Del Vallès
    ID 78705
    600 m • 8 min
  • 2
    Train - R12
    Wait for train
    R12
    Lleida - Pirineus
  • 3
    Ride to train station
    Ride to train station
    Bellpuig
    ID 78406
    138 min
  • 4
    Walk to Bellpuig
    Walk to
    Bellpuig
    170 m • 3 min
*Duration based on 8am traffic
The Most Popular Urban Mobility App in Barcelona.
All local mobility options in one app

Public transit directions from Barberà Del Vallès to Bellpuig

The distance between Barberà Del Vallès, Barcelona and Bellpuig, Barcelona is approximately 132.71 km, which can typically be travelled in 151 min. Moovit will show you the directions from Barberà Del Vallès to Bellpuig by train, so no matter how you choose to travel in Barcelona – you will always have plenty of easy options.

Public transit stations close to Barberà Del Vallès

Barberà Del Vallès is located at Barberà Del Vallès, Barcelona and the nearest public transit station is Dr. Moragas/Rda. De L´Est.

Train stations close to Barberà Del Vallès:

  • Barberà Del Vallès
  • Sabadell Sud
  • Universitat Autònoma

Bus stations close to Barberà Del Vallès:

  • Dr. Moragas/Rda. De L´Est
  • Dr.Moragas/Pl. De La Vila
  • Dr.Moragas / Pl. De La Vila

Public transit stations close to Bellpuig, Barcelona

Bellpuig is located at Bellpuig, Barcelona and the nearest public transit station is Avinguda De Les Garrigues (Bellpuig).

Train stations close to Bellpuig:

  • Bellpuig
  • Castellnou De Seana

Bus stations close to Bellpuig:

  • Avinguda De Les Garrigues (Bellpuig)
  • Bellpuig (Av. De Lleida, 26)
  • Bellpuig (Av. De Lleida, 53)

Questions & Answers

  • What is the fastest way to get from Barberà Del Vallès to Bellpuig?

    The fastest way takes 151 minutes, using Bus line R12.

  • Is there a direct train between Barberà Del Vallès and Bellpuig in Barcelona?

    Yes, there is a direct train going from Barberà Del Vallès to Bellpuig in Barcelona in 2 hr 31 min.

  • Which train line goes from Barberà Del Vallès to Bellpuig in Barcelona?

    The R12 train line goes from Barberà Del Vallès station near Barberà Del Vallès to Lleida - Pirineus station near Bellpuig in Barcelona.

  • How long does it take to travel from Barberà Del Vallès to Bellpuig in Barcelona by train?

    The total travel time between Barberà Del Vallès and Bellpuig in Barcelona by train is about 2 hr 31 min.

  • Where do I get on the train near Barberà Del Vallès to get to Bellpuig in Barcelona?

    Get on the R12 train from the Barberà Del Vallès station near Barberà Del Vallès in Barcelona.

  • Where do I get off the train when travelling between Barberà Del Vallès and Bellpuig in Barcelona?

    Get off the train at the Lleida - Pirineus station, which is closest to Bellpuig in Barcelona.

  • When is the last train from Barberà Del Vallès to Bellpuig in Barcelona?

    The last train from Barberà Del Vallès to Bellpuig in Barcelona is the L'Hospitalet de Llobregat - Lleida line. It leaves the Barberà Del Vallès station at 9:10 PM.

  • How much is the train fare from Barberà Del Vallès to Bellpuig?

    The ride from Barberà Del Vallès to Bellpuig costs €5.90.

Real-Time Arrivals, Schedules, Maps & More